// Form1加载事件 private void Form1_Load(object sender, EventArgs e) { if (!bInitialized) { // 初始化进程守卫对象 InitializeProcessUnique(); // 初始化绘制窗口,启动编辑器线程 InitializeWindow(RenderPanel.Handle, true, (uint)RenderPanel.Width, (uint)RenderPanel.Height); // 设置日志回调 DelegateLogger = new PFN_Logger(OnLogging); SetLogger(DelegateLogger); // 加载用户本地数据 LoadLocalUserData(); bInitialized = true; } }
public static extern void SetLogger(PFN_Logger logger);